Vatican City: The Pope is publicly applauding priests for being a "gift" to both the church and the world, despite the clergy abuse scandals that have saddened or angered many Catholics.
Pope Benedict XVI says priests — from saints and martyrs to the unheralded pastors toiling in tiny parishes — have been key to bringing what he called authentic spiritual and social renewal throughout history.
The Pope, who was addressing pilgrims Sunday in St. Peter`s Square, made no mention of the scandals tainting the church. He said God`s love gives priests the ability to forgive their enemies.
On Friday, Benedict begged forgiveness from victims of priests who sexually abused them and made a symbolic pledge to do everything possible to protect children.
